How to get silver in Subnautica 2
This guide details how to find silver in Subnautica 2, a crucial crafting material for items like the air tank and wiring kits. Silver can be found in small nodes or larger blocks that require the Sonic Resonator, with good locations near the starting Lifepod and the Old Habitat colony ruins.

How to get the Wakemaker in Subnautica 2
This guide explains how to obtain the Wakemaker, an early-game upgrade for faster swimming and longer underwater duration in Subnautica 2. Players need to scan three Wakemaker fragments found at specific science lab locations. Once scanned, the Wakemaker can be crafted using basic materials like silver, wiring kits, grease, and batteries.

How to get Acidic Raion Pouch in Subnautica 2
This guide explains how to find Acidic Raion Pouches in Subnautica 2, a crucial component for crafting the scanner's basic battery. The pouches are harvested from purple, brain-shaped plants called Acid Raions, which can be found in caves near the starting Lifepod. Players will need a Survival Multitool to harvest them and should collect the pouches before the Medical Gel Sack to avoid acid damage.
How to get the Sonic Resonator and mine in Subnautica 2
This guide explains how to obtain the Sonic Resonator tool in Subnautica 2, which is essential for mining large ore deposits and destroying Bloom Biofilm. Players need to scan two fragments to unlock the blueprint and then craft it using specific materials like titanium ingots and lead.

How to unlock Digestion in Subnautica 2
This guide explains how to unlock the Digestion Adaptation in Subnautica 2, a crucial mechanic for survival. Players must find an Angel Comb bulb in the ocean north of their Lifepod to gain the ability to eat fish without negative side effects, which also unlocks the Habitat Builder blueprint.

How to get lithium in Subnautica 2
This guide details how to locate and gather lithium in Subnautica 2, a rare metal found primarily in The Great Jaw early in the game. Players will need specific equipment like the Sonic Resonator and Standard Air Tank to access the lithium within the giant mouth structure. Later in the game, lithium can also be found in hot caves below the Tadpole Pens.
How to get salt in Subnautica 2
This guide explains how to find salt in Subnautica 2, a crucial ingredient for crafting Power Cells and the Tadpole vehicle. Salt can be found early in a cave southeast of the Lifepod, near Chap's black box, and also respawns over time. Additional locations include the volcanic vents area and deeper regions like The Great Jaw, though the latter requires Heat Tolerance adaptation.
How to get sulfur in Subnautica 2
This guide explains how to find sulfur in Subnautica 2, a crucial resource for crafting the Repair Tool and other items. Sulfur can be found as yellowish crystals on rock pillars southeast of the Lifepod, with larger deposits requiring the Sonic Resonator for mining. The Repair Tool is essential for accessing shipwrecks and obtaining the Rebreather.

How to build a Tadpole in Subnautica 2
This guide details how to find and craft the Tadpole vehicle in Subnautica 2. Players must scan three Tadpole fragments scattered across various early-game locations, including the Old Habitat and ravines near the Lifepod. Once the blueprint is unlocked, players will need to construct a Moonpool, Tadpole Dock, and Vehicle Fabricator in their base, gathering resources like titanium, copper wire, glass, and a power cell.
How to get gold in Subnautica 2
This guide explains how to find gold in Subnautica 2, a crucial resource for crafting items like the Advanced Wiring Kit and System Chip, as well as building structures such as the Thermal Plant. Gold can be found in volcanic vent regions, particularly around a crashed colony ship east of the Lifepod, but players will need the Heat Tolerance adaptation to survive the environment.
